Vehicle Suspension: Comfort, Control & Common Problems

The design of the suspension system, which transmits force between the vehicle and the ground, is principally responsible for the driving comfort of a vehicle. Importantly, a vehicle’s suspension system contributes to the reliability and precision of steering and control, as well as to the friction between the vehicle and the road. The suspension system is also responsible for absorbing and dampening road stress, so that we do not feel every bump on the road when driving. This paper introduced the most common suspension problems and the symptoms that may indicate you need a suspension system repair, such as faulty shocks or struts, damaged springs, and faulty control arms.

Importance of Suspension Components

Understanding the specific roles of shocks, struts, and control arms is vital for maintaining vehicle safety. Each component serves a unique function that contributes to the overall performance of the suspension system.

Shocks

Shocks, or shock absorbers, are designed to control the impact and rebound of the vehicle’s springs. They absorb road impacts, maintaining vehicle control and comfort. Worn shocks can lead to excessive bouncing and poor handling, making it difficult to control the vehicle, especially during turns or sudden stops.

Struts

Struts serve a dual purpose in the suspension system. They not only absorb shocks but also provide structural support to the vehicle. Struts help maintain the vehicle’s alignment and stability, which is crucial for safe handling. If struts are worn, they can cause the vehicle to feel unstable, leading to a bumpy ride and increased wear on tires.

Control Arms

Control arms connect the suspension to the vehicle’s chassis, allowing for controlled movement of the wheels. They play a significant role in maintaining proper wheel alignment and handling. Damaged control arms can lead to misalignment, causing uneven tire wear and poor handling characteristics. Recognizing signs of control arm issues, such as clunking noises or a pulling sensation while driving, is essential for timely repairs.

How Do Shocks Improve Vehicle Stability?

Shocks improve vehicle stability by controlling the movement of the suspension system. They dampen the oscillations caused by road irregularities, ensuring that the tires maintain contact with the road surface. This contact is essential for effective steering and braking, making shocks a vital component of vehicle safety.

Shock Absorber Diagnostics & Braking Safety

The practical problems that usually come up during the on-vehicle testing of motor car shock absorbers have been discussed. It has also been shown that the wear of shock absorbers may affect the value of braking deceleration of cars with ABS (anti-lock braking system) when moving on uneven ground. The main objective of the work was to assess usefulness and reliability of various diagnostic methods intended for the on-vehicle testing of car shock absorbers.

How to Recognize Signs Your Suspension Needs Repair

Recognizing the signs that your suspension needs repair is crucial for maintaining vehicle safety. Common symptoms include:

  1. Unusual Noises: Clunking or knocking sounds when driving over bumps.
  2. Bumpy Ride: Excessive bouncing or a rough ride can indicate worn shocks or struts.
  3. Fluid Leaks: Leaking fluid around shocks or struts is a sign of failure.

If you notice any of these symptoms, it’s important to seek professional help.

What Are Common Symptoms of Bad Shocks and Struts?

Bad shocks and struts can lead to several noticeable symptoms, including:

  • Clunking Noises: Sounds when driving over bumps can indicate worn components.
  • Poor Handling: Difficulty steering or maintaining control can signal suspension issues.
  • Excessive Bouncing: A bouncy ride indicates that shocks or struts may need replacement.

How Can Control Arm Issues Affect Vehicle Handling?

Control arm issues can significantly impact vehicle handling. If control arms are damaged, they can cause the vehicle to pull to one side, leading to uneven tire wear and a bumpy ride. Addressing control arm problems promptly is essential for maintaining safe driving conditions.

What Are the Costs and Processes for Suspension Repair in Bridgeport, OH?

Mechanic's workspace with suspension repair tools and a price list, illustrating the costs of suspension repairs

The costs for suspension repair can vary based on the specific services needed. Here are some average pricing estimates for common suspension repairs in Bridgeport, OH:

ServiceEstimated Cost
Shock Absorber Replacement$250 – $500
Strut Replacement$400 – $1,200
Control Arm Replacement$250 – $500
Ball Joint Replacement$150 – $300

Understanding these costs can help you budget for necessary repairs.
